Please note, that due to the unrest in the Ukraine , that shipments of Surplus Rifles and Ammunition has all but stopped. While we had a large stock pile of these rifles just after Christmas, the last few weeks has depleted our inventory. In the last 3 days we went from 60 laminate stock SKS rifles to 0. We are able to buy more stock, however prices have started to rise. If you have been holding off purchasing a SVT-40, Russian SKS, or Mosin Nagant, now is the time to buy, not only before the prices go up, but before the supply runs dry.
We still have a decent supply of SVT40s and 1891/30s at the old price, however what we thought looking like a 5 month supply now looks more like a 5 week supply at the way things are selling.
Russian SKS rifles are nearly gone (These come Via The Ukraine).
We were told that the Norinco SKS rifles are now going up by 80%. We still have some left at the old price.
